¿Cómo hacer un robot usando Arduino? Solo tengo 7 meses. Es posible

Arduino proporciona pines GPIO, PWM y ADC, así como pines para la comunicación a través de USART, SPI, I2C.
La funcionalidad del robot se puede determinar según qué periféricos puede conectar a ella:

  • GPIO: Sí / No entrada salida. Por ejemplo: interruptores, luces, sensor de agua.
  • PWM: motores, también puede funcionar como DAC
  • ADC: entrada analógica como sensor de luz, sensor de proximidad, sensor de presión, sensores de sonido
  • Comunicación: con sensores como acelerómetro, giroscopio, magnetómetro, IMU (AHRS), GPS, WiFi, otros arduinos

Esto puede ayudarlo a hacer (con electrónica y circuitos adicionales disponibles):

  • Robot simple con accionamiento diferencial
  • Seguidor de línea (sensores de luz + motores)
  • Seguidor de pared (sensor de proximidad + motores)
  • Solucionador de laberintos (igual que seguidor de pared, pero lógica más complicada). Ver también micro-mouse
  • Bot controlado por voz (micrófono + motores + cualquier otra cosa)
  • Adjunte una pinza a cualquiera de los bot para su manipulación a través de GPIO / PWM
  • Quadcopter (pero recomiendo PX4 para esto) y otras máquinas voladoras
  • Barcos (con algo de impermeabilización, igual que un robot simple)
  • Robot humanoide (tomará una serie de arduinos, y mucha planificación, mucho conocimiento de controles y mucha paciencia)
  • Robots enjambre (para lograr alguna misión como cruzar un puente después de construirlo. Muy complicado, incluye el uso de varios sensores, así como una lógica de alto orden y una comunicación intensa entre cada robot. Requiere el Mega Arduino)

Los anteriores se enumeran en orden creciente de dificultad de implementación, incluido el software, el hardware y la electrónica de soporte.
Que te diviertas.

Si, es totalmente posible. Puede construir un simple robot con ruedas controlado por Arduino en menos de una semana. Puede comenzar con algunos kits básicos de robots Arduino como SparkFun Inventor’s Kit para RedBot o
Arduino – Robot

También hay varios tutoriales en línea para aprender electrónica básica e ingeniería mecánica requerida para robots simples.

Para robots complicados o robots andantes, todavía es factible. Sin embargo, recomendaría tener un equipo para construir robots.

Es posible. Hice muchos robots en arduino en solo 2-3 semanas.

OneDrive

Si desea hacer un prototipo de robot en 2–3 días, utilice el kit de robot Artek. Este kit de robot utiliza un microcontrolador compatible con Arduino, capaz de programar desde cero y crear un robot fácilmente con bloques.

ArtecRobo | Artec Co., LTD.

7 meses r más que suficiente para arduino
comience con lo básico no profundice solo aprenda qué hace qué en lugar de aprender
¿Por qué algo hace esto?
También puede desarrollar seguidor de línea, reconocedor de ruta, solucionador de patrones, quadrocopter, robot excavador

Tienes 7 meses! ¡El tiempo es más que suficiente!
Conéctese en línea y solo busque “Cómo hacer un robot simple usando arduino” y también mire algunos videos de YouTube para tener una idea.
Esta será su respuesta a todas las preguntas. Te dará muchos tipos de ideas
¡Incluso una persona de ramas pequeñas como la rama de seguridad contra incendios también puede hacer robots!

7 meses es mucho tiempo para aprender y perfeccionar su aplicación basada en arduino.
Ponte en contacto conmigo en Facebook y rebotaremos sobre algunas ideas de lo que puedes construir.
PD: Tengo experiencia en informática.

More Interesting

¿Debería AI convertirse en un jugador político? Por ejemplo, en el futuro, ¿deberían los políticos tener que debatir con AI que calcula presupuestos y políticas?

¿Cuál es la explicación simple del algoritmo M5P (árboles modelo M5) en aprendizaje automático / minería de datos?

¿Cuán inteligente puede crecer la inteligencia artificial basada en computadoras cuánticas, considerando las complejidades matemáticas de los diferentes problemas de inteligencia artificial?

¿Qué tan lejos estamos de los AI de bricolaje capaces de investigar en Internet y proporcionar resúmenes?

¿Cuán innovador es el reciente experimento que supuestamente muestra autoconciencia en los robots NAO?

¿Hay publicaciones sobre la generación automática de video a partir de texto plano y viceversa?

¿Por qué los viejos modelos de redes neuronales, como las máquinas Boltzmann, han quedado fuera de la mira?

¿Cómo podemos usar algoritmos genéticos para resolver sistemas de ecuaciones lineales (o no lineales)?

¿Qué tipo de antecedentes matemáticos son beneficiosos para alguien que comienza a programar en IA?

¿La IA tiene futuro y puede ser accesible?

¿Necesitamos nuevos tipos de hardware para pasar la prueba de Turing?

¿Puede alguien que no es dotado naturalmente en matemáticas contribuir positivamente a la investigación de CS / machine learning?

¿Por qué el Servicio Meteorológico Nacional no usa inteligencia artificial para predecir el clima?

Quiero construir un robot autónomo. Debe poder mirar a su alrededor y juzgar a dónde debe ir. ¿Qué conocimiento necesito para lograr esto?

¿Estoy atrapado entre tomar un título en ciencias de la computación enfocado en Inteligencia Artificial y un título en Ingeniería Mecatrónica? Detalles: